TXN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2017 in Review

1,314 of the 4,409 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Texas Instruments (TXN) for Q4 2017, worth a combined $87.6B — up 17% from $75.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 216 funds opened new TXN positions and 54 closed out — a net gain of 162 holders — while 417 added to existing stakes and 486 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$621M. The largest seller was Capital Research Global Investors, cutting an estimated $415M.
